Regular inspections are important for ensuring that a garage door operates easily and safely. A well-timed garage door inspection can prevent minor issues from escalating into major repairs.
One of the first issues to check throughout a garage door inspection is the door's hardware. Bolts, screws, and hinges can become loose over time. Tightening these components will assist ensure a smoother operation and extend the lifespan of the door. Regularly inspecting the hardware can save time and money by preventing future malfunctions.
The rollers are one other key part that must be fastidiously examined. Most garage doors operate with rollers that glide alongside the track to open and close smoothly. If these rollers turn out to be worn or broken, they will result in vital problems. During the inspection, verify for signs of damage, such as cracks or a rough texture.

The tracks themselves should even be in good condition. They must be aligned and free from debris. A simple cleaning of the track can improve efficiency and prevent derailment
Another crucial side to assess is the door’s balance. An unbalanced garage door can lead to pointless pressure on the opener and the door itself. Checking the balance is comparatively easy; manually open the garage door midway and let go. If it doesn’t stay in place, it could need additional changes or repairs.
Safety options should not be ignored during a garage door inspection. Most fashionable garage doors are geared up with sensors that prevent the door from closing on objects in its path. A simple methodology is to place an object within the door's path and see if it reverses when it comes into contact. Ensuring these safety options perform is important for preventing accidents
Weather stripping is one other component usually neglected. This part is crucial for power efficiency. Inspect the climate stripping for wear or gaps that might let in drafts or water. Replacing damaged elements can outcome in significant power financial savings and maintain a snug environment in your garage.

The opener mechanism warrants close scrutiny during an inspection as properly. Whether it operates through remote management or a wall-mounted button, making certain it's functioning accurately is crucial. Listen for unusual sounds throughout operation, which may signal a problem. Lubrication can also be required for smoother operation.
Regular inspections ought to embody checking the springs, which are beneath excessive pressure. They could be harmful if improperly handled. If you discover any signs of wear or if the springs seem stretched, it's clever to hunt professional help. This is an space the place DIY repairs may be dangerous with out the right data and instruments.
Cleaning is an often-overlooked aspect of sustaining a garage door. A build-up of dust or grime can have an result on its efficiency. Regular washing with cleaning soap and water may help hold the garage door free from particles, permitting for smoother operation. Clean elements are much less prone to malfunction over time.
Documenting the findings of every inspection is advisable. Keeping a report of the condition of your garage door can help track changes over time. Noting issues can even help in prioritizing necessary repairs, making it easier to manage maintenance schedules effectively.
